We have an exciting new opportunity for an Analysis Manager role.  We're looking for the right candidate to join our Group Transformation and Change Team, working within our Digital portfolio which is currently focused on delivering our digital first communications strategy.  You'll help deliver system capabilities to support the digital fulfilment of communications, understanding how our business processes integrate with the technology platforms to support this. This is an exciting time to join our team, as we shape the future of our Digital offering and build new capabilities together.

As an Analysis Manager, you will take ownership for shaping the bigger picture through delivery and oversight of detailed business designs, processes and functionality that support the business needs to the agreed timescales and quality.  You will also manage a Team of Business Analysts supporting them within their delivery as well as their growth and development.  You will seek to foster a high performing, engaged team.

About Royal London

We're the UK's largest mutual life, pensions and investment company, offering protection, long-term savings and asset management products and services.    

Our People Promise to our colleagues is that we will all work somewhere inclusive, responsible, enjoyable and fulfilling. This is underpinned by our Spirit of Royal London values; Empowered, Trustworthy, Collaborate, Achieve. 

We've always been proud to reward employees by offering great workplace benefits such as 28 days annual leave in addition to bank holidays, an up to 14% employer matching pension scheme and private medical insurance. You can see all our benefits here - Our Benefits
